Sto cercando di apportare alcune personalizzazioni alla visualizzazione mobile del nostro forum. Abbiamo impostato lo “Stile della pagina categoria desktop” nelle impostazioni su “Categorie e argomenti più recenti”, il che funziona bene. Ma su mobile, questo non si riflette e possiamo impostarlo ovunque nelle impostazioni?
Al momento su mobile, gli argomenti su ogni bacheca sono molto casuali. Alcuni sono argomenti fissati vecchi e altri sono i più recenti. Come possiamo cambiare questo, per favore?
Non credo ci sia un modo per avere la visualizzazione delle categorie e degli argomenti più recenti sul cellulare a causa delle restrizioni dello spazio sullo schermo.
Quello screenshot della tua visualizzazione mobile è per un utente non registrato, il che significa che vedrà sempre tutti gli argomenti fissati in alto perché in quello stato, Discourse non sa se li ha letti o meno. Avrà un aspetto diverso se lo visualizzi da registrato.
Hai ancora un problema da risolvere se sei registrato?
Hmm, ma questo è il problema che il mio cliente sta riscontrando: gli utenti disconnessi vedono questi argomenti bloccati dal 2022 e potrebbero pensare che il forum sia obsoleto.
Quale sarebbe la soluzione qui? Dobbiamo sbloccare questi argomenti in modo che l’utente disconnesso veda gli argomenti più recenti? Possiamo aggiornare la data dell’argomento?
–
Quando l’utente è connesso e fa clic su quegli argomenti bloccati e poi torna alla homepage. L’argomento bloccato viene semplicemente visualizzato in grigio. Non lo rimuove completamente.
Il fatto è che la persona con cui sei ora connesso non ha letto questi argomenti bloccati. Sono progettati per rimanere bloccati finché un individuo non li legge, a quel punto diventano non bloccati per quell’individuo specifico.
Quindi, o questi argomenti sono abbastanza importanti da farli leggere a tutti ed è per questo che sono bloccati, oppure non lo sono, nel qual caso li sblocchi e non rimarranno più sopra gli ultimi.
Se leggono il post, questo verrà automaticamente bloccato per loro.
Se accedi e leggi i post bloccati, cosa vedi quindi nella schermata principale?
Mi è successo di recente. Il caso era un forum con un sacco di argomenti bloccati dal 2021 che erano stati anche chiusi. È chiaro che vogliono mantenere gli argomenti bloccati, ma vedere le date vecchie in cima a un elenco di argomenti fa sembrare che il forum non riceva molta attività.
Sì. Come utente amministratore, vai all’argomento bloccato e fai clic sull’icona della chiave inglese dell’amministratore che si trova in alto a destra della pagina. Seleziona “Cambia data e ora” dal menu a discesa. Ciò ti consentirà di aggiornare la data dell’argomento.
Un altro modo per affrontare il problema sarebbe nascondere le date degli argomenti bloccati con CSS. Qualcosa di simile a quanto segue, aggiunto al tuo tema o a un componente del tema, dovrebbe funzionare:
Sì, su mobile c’è un solo modello per la pagina delle categorie e mostra le categorie con argomenti in primo piano. Suppongo che la soluzione più semplice sarebbe, come già menzionato da @HAWK, utilizzare il componente Force Mobile Homepage e impostare la homepage mobile su “Latest”, che è l’elenco globale degli argomenti più recenti.
Tuttavia, se lo fai, ti consiglio anche di regolare il menu di navigazione, in modo che gli utenti mobili possano navigare meglio tra l’elenco degli argomenti, le categorie e altre pagine. Al momento hai solo link esterni e categorie nel menu:
Di solito è uno schema più chiaro avere le voci di navigazione principali per il forum in alto e racchiudere i link esterni in una sezione dedicata. In questo modo non ci sono elementi a sorpresa per la navigazione fuori dal forum. Ecco un esempio da un’altra community di Discourse: